Ordinance No. 58461 o ORDINANCE NO. 584 A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CYPRESS AMENDING ORDINANCE NO. 559, THE ZONING ORDINANCE OF SAID CITY, AND SPECIFICALLY SECTIONS 8, 15.1 , 15.3 AND 16.8 D THEREOF, RELATING TO THE CONSTRUCTION, MAINTENANCE AND AMORTIZATION OF SIGNS. TH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CYPRESS HEREBY DOES ORDAIN AS FOLLOWS: SECTION 1. Section 8 of Ordinance No. 559 hereby is amended to add thereto the following definitions: BILLBOARD shall mean any outdoor advertising display generally used for the advertisement of goods produced or services rendered at a location or locations other than the premises on which said display is located. SECTION 2. Section 15.1 of Ordinance No. 559 hereby is amended by changing subsection (N) thereof to read as follows: N. Signs painted on the sides of buildings may be permitted to the extent allowed in the various zones provided, however, that such signs shall not cover more than 10% of the area of the side of the building on which the sign is to be located, and provided, further, that all such signs shall be subject to the review and approval of the Planning Commission in accordance of the design review section of the Zoning Ordinance. SECTION 3. Section 15.1 of Ordinance No. 559 hereby is further amended by changing subsection (0) thereof to read as follows: 0. Signs shall not blink, flash, or be animated by lighting in any fashion in any zone. SECTION 4. Section 15.3 of Ordinance No. 559 hereby is amended by adding thereto a subsection (G) to read as follows: G. Billboards Billboards may be permitted within the City of Cypress subject to the following conditions and restrictions: 1. Billboards shall be permitted in the CH -10000 Zone only provided that a conditional use permit therefore has been granted. 2. No new billboard shall be permitted within 300 feet of a residential zone. 3. No new billboard shall be permitted within a 1500 foot radius of of an existing billboard. 4. Billboards shall be placed on independent structures only, which structures shall contain no more than two supports, and which supports shall be of steel. 5. All billboards shall conform to the following development standards: a. Maximum height - 30 feet b. Maximum area - 300 square feet c. Minimum ground clearance - 8 feet d. No movement, blinking, flashing or animation of any kind. e. No projection into or over any public right -of -way. f. Minimum setback requirements for the CH -10000 Zone. g. Lighting shall be by indirect source (shielded) provided such lighting shall not exceed 800 milliamps rated capacity or equivalent as determined by the Building Superintendent. 6. If any billboard is left blank or is maintained without copy for a period of 60 days or more, such billboard shall be removed within six months unless a conditional use permit is approved for its re -use. 7. Any billboard which does not conform to the provisions of this subsection shall be modified or removed in accordance with the following provisions: a. Billboards with an appraised value of less than $200 shall be brought into conformance or removed within one (1) year of the effective date of this Ordinance No. 584; or within such shorter period of time as may be applicable thereto under the provisions of Section 16.8. b. Billboards with an appraised value of more than $200 shall be brought into conformance within three (3) years of the effective date of this Ordinance No. 584 or within such shorter period of time as may be applicable thereto under the provisions of Section 16.8. Appraised value of billboards shall be as determined by the City Building Superintendent. Any such appraisal shall be subject to review by the City Council if such review is requested by the owner of such billboard or by the owner of the property on which such billboard is situated. 8. If only one side of the structure is covered with advertising, the back of the billboard shall be covered with suitable material and maintained to the specifications of the City Code and City staff. 9. Only one (1) billboard may be constructed on any one parcel of land. SECTION 5. Section 16.8 D of Ordinance No. 559 hereby is amended by changing subsection (3) thereof to read as follows: 3. In any zone, elimination of non - conforming lighting or movement. 6 months SECTION 6. Section 16.8 D of Ordinance No. 559 hereby is further amended by adding subsection (5) to read as follows: 5. In any zone, removal of signs which project into or over public right -of -way. 1 year SECTION 7. Severability. The City Council of the City of Cypress hereby declares that should any section, paragraph, sentence, or word of this Chapter of the Code, hereby adopted, be declared for any reason to be invalid, it is the intent of the Council that it would have passed all other portions of this Chapter independent of the elimination herefrom of any such portion as may be declared invalid. FIRST READ at a regular meeting of the City Council of said City held on the 13th day of September 1976, and finally adopted and ordered posted at a regular meeting of said Council held on the 27th day of September 1976.
